Do you get scared of baking Cheesecakes? Well fear no more! This Basque style cheesecake is all the things we usually avoid - it's BURNT, it's CRACKED, it's SUNK. and its utterly delicious! Invented in the Basque country this Cheesecake has no biscuit base, instead you get the slightly crisp texture and amazing caramelised flavour from the burnt crust. If you prefer a slightly looser centre feel free to bake for around 40-45 minutes rather than the 50 minutes as stated in the video. 8 Cake Tin 600g Cream Cheese at room temp 225g Caster Sugar 4 Eggs Pinch of Salt 300g Double Cream (heavy cream) 1 tsp Vanilla Extract (Get yours here ) 40g Plain Flour
